Brazilian Rosewood Santa Cruz Demo

This used Santa Cruz 1934-D, from 2021, is an absolutely stunning example of a modern, vintage-inspired dreadnought. Featuring an Adirondack spruce top paired with a gorgeous set of Brazilian rosewood for the back and sides, this guitar has that lush rosewood sound, with a clear and articulate tone, absent any of the boom associated with rosewood guitars. Mass Street Music Repair Shop – Custom Bridge Top

Some good ol’ fashioned hand work on display up the in the repair shop. Here, Mass Street luthier Matt H is working to fabricate a replica Gibson L-5 bridge top for a customer. The bridge in the foreground is there for reference as he files away material to recreate the angles and lines of the original. Got a repair project of your own? Browne Amplification – Atom Nashville Demo

The new Atom Nashville Overdrive from Browne Amplification bring the “Green” side of their popular Protein to it’s own standalone enclosure. The ‘Green Side’ delivers a classic Nashville-style overdrive, that brings a compressed, chewy and darker overdrive sound, with some added mid-range punch and a tighter low-end that eliminates some of the woofiness in the bass. Vintage Gibson Guitars 1935 L-5 – Demo

It is hard to get more iconic in the world of vintage acoustic archtops than this. Say hello to this stunning 1935 Gibson L-5 that recently landed here at the shop. An early ‘35 L-5, this guitar retains the original 16” body sought after by so many players today.
